1. Regular Veterinary Check-ups

Regular visits to the veterinarian become even more crucial as your Whippet ages. Schedule comprehensive check-ups at least twice a year to monitor their overall health, detect any potential issues early on, and receive guidance on appropriate preventative care measures.

2. Appropriate Diet and Nutrition

A well-balanced diet tailored to your senior Whippet's needs is vital for maintaining their health. Consult with your veterinarian to determine the most suitable diet plan, which may include high-quality senior dog food formulated to meet their specific nutritional requirements. Keep an eye on their weight to prevent obesity or excessive weight loss.

3. Joint Health and Mobility

Whippets, like many larger dog breeds, are prone to joint issues such as arthritis as they age. To support their joint health and mobility, consider providing them with joint supplements recommended by your veterinarian. Ensure they have comfortable bedding and avoid placing excessive strain on their joints during exercise.

4. Regular Exercise

While your senior Whippet may not be as energetic as before, regular exercise remains essential for their overall well-being. Adjust the intensity and duration of exercise to match their energy levels and physical capabilities. Short, gentle walks and low-impact activities like swimming can help maintain muscle tone and keep them mentally stimulated.

5. Dental Care

Proper dental care is crucial for senior Whippets, as dental issues become more common with age. Regularly brush their teeth using dog-specific toothpaste and provide appropriate chew toys to promote dental health. Schedule professional dental cleanings if recommended by your veterinarian.

6. Mental Stimulation

Keeping your senior Whippet mentally stimulated is key to their happiness and cognitive health. Engage them in interactive play, provide puzzle toys, and continue training sessions with positive reinforcement techniques to keep their minds sharp and prevent boredom.

7. Monitor Vision and Hearing

As your Whippet ages, their vision and hearing may decline. Be observant of any changes in their behavior or responsiveness and consult your veterinarian if you notice significant alterations. Make adjustments to their environment, such as using night lights, to help them navigate their surroundings more easily.

8. Manage Stress and Anxiety

Some senior Whippets may experience increased anxiety or stress as they age. Provide a calm and peaceful environment, establish routines, and offer comforting measures such as soft bedding and soothing music. If necessary, discuss anxiety management techniques or medications with your veterinarian.

9. Consider Age-Appropriate Activities

Engaging in age-appropriate activities can enhance your senior Whippet's well-being. This may include gentle obedience training, nose work games, or even joining therapy dog programs if they enjoy interacting with people. These activities promote mental stimulation, companionship, and a sense of purpose.
